Bangalore-based Sunitha Kondur is the co-founder and director of Hundredhands, an award-winning architecture and interior design firm. She co-founded the firm with Bijoy Ramachandran in 2003. She received her master’s degree from MIT in Boston and her bachelor’s degree from BMS College of Engineering. Kondur has previously served as a project manager at the Mass State College Building Authority and the notable Houses at Sagaponac Project in New York. In addition to shaping architectural landscapes, Kondur founded Source—a company for materials, product, and furniture sourcing. Her commitment to the revival and integration of Indian art and craft is woven into the fabric of the firm’s work. Beyond her creative endeavours, Sunitha is also the driving force and the co-founder of WIREnet World (Women in Real Estate Network), a professional network empowering women in design, real estate, and construction through knowledge sharing and mentoring.
